According to the Pakistan Economic Survey 2024–25, the installed electricity generation capacity reached 46,605 MW in March 2025, reflecting an increase of 1.6% from previous year.     For Iceland, you'll need a Type F adapter (also known as Schuko) for most of your electronics. This adapter is compatible with the standard outlets used in Iceland. Always check your device's voltage requirements to ensure they match Iceland's 230V supply or that you have a suitable.
